What's the best time of year to book my B&B in Kincasslagh?
When you’re planning your getaway to Kincasslagh, year-round temperatures and rainfall may be important factors to consider. The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 13°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 5°C. Average annual precipitation for Kincasslagh is 1620 mm.

How can I get to and around Kincasslagh?
Mapping out your trip in and around Kincasslagh is easy with these transportation options. Fly into Donegal (CFN), which is located 2.2 mi (3.5 km) from the city centre. Otherwise, look for flights into Letterkenny (LTR-Letterkenny Airfield), which is 29.2 mi (47 km) away. If you’d like to venture out around the area, consider renting a car to explore more sights.
